WP7用のAmChartsを使用してタイムラインを表示するにはどうすればよいですか
-
27-10-2019 - |
質問
私はWP7にタイムラインを表示しようとしています AmCharts QuickCharts.
<amq:SerialChart DataSource="{Binding MyData}"
CategoryValueMemberPath="Date"
AxisForeground="White"
PlotAreaBackground="Black"
GridStroke="Gray"
Margin="1"
>
<amq:SerialChart.Graphs>
<amq:LineGraph ValueMemberPath="Score"
Title="Scores"
Brush="Blue"/>
</amq:SerialChart.Graphs>
</amq:SerialChart>
MyData
です ObservableCollection<ScoreDate>
どこ ScoreDate
と定義されている
public class ScoreDate
{
public int Score{get;set;}
public DateTime Date{get;set;}
}
問題は、X軸が個々の値としてプロットされ、データなしで期間をスキップするだけであり、私が必要としているように分散したタイムラインのイベントとしてではないことです。
AmChartsにそれをさせる方法はありますか?
解決
WP7のAmChartsは単純すぎて明らかに放棄されているため、これは簡単な偉業ではありません。
私がやったことは、キャンバスにポリラインを使用して自分のグラフを作成し、ポイントコレクションにデータバウンドを作成することでした。
グラフをかなり速く手に入れました。
所属していません StackOverflow